Program Structure and Learning Format


Both programs are delivered online and designed for flexibility.


  • Clinical Skills Institute offers a self-paced program that can be completed in as little as 8–12 weeks

  • U.S. Career Institute also provides self-paced coursework, typically completed in 4–7 months depending on pace 


👉 Key difference:


  • Clinical Skills Institute is designed for faster completion

  • USCI is structured for a longer learning timeline


Certification Preparation (CCMA)

This Clinical Skills Institute vs U.S. Career Institute comparison highlights key differences in program structure, flexibility, and overall approach.


Both programs prepare students for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) certification, which is widely recognized in healthcare.

Clinical Skills Institute vs. U.S. Career Institute:


  • USCI includes curriculum designed to prepare students for certification exams

  • Clinical Skills Institute focuses specifically on certification-aligned training and exam readiness


👉 Important:

Certification is often more important than the program itself, since employers prioritize certified candidates.

Externship and Clinical Experience


Externship is where these programs differ more clearly.

Clinical Skills Institute vs. U.S. Career Institute:


  • Clinical Skills Institute provides structured guaranteed externship designed to help students secure clinical experience locally

  • U.S. Career Institute is more self-directed, with less emphasis on structured externship pathways

Some student discussions note that externship may not be included directly in certain self-paced programs and may require independent effort.

Accreditation and Program Model


U.S. Career Institute is a nationally accredited online institution (DEAC) 

Clinical Skills Institute is an accredited program by National Healthcareer Association (NHA), emphasizing practical healthcare skills and CCMA exam preparation rather than traditional academic pathways.

Is certification required to become a medical assistant?

Certification is not always required, but many employers prefer candidates who have completed certification such as the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) through the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

How does externship help in getting a job?

Externship provides real-world clinical experience, allowing students to build confidence, develop practical skills, and demonstrate readiness to employers in healthcare settings.
